**China Next Generation Wireless Communication Market Drivers**

**Growing Demand for High-Speed Internet Connectivity**

In recent years, the demand for high-speed internet connectivity has surged across China, driven by the increasing reliance on digital technologies and online services. The Chinese government has emphasized the importance of broadband access, aligning with its ambition to become a global leader in technological innovation. According to the Ministry of Industry and Information Technology, as of 2022, over 98% of urban households in China have access to fiber-optic broadband services, which represents a significant increase from previous years.

The rapid digitalization across various sectors, including education and healthcare, has created a path for the China [Next Generation Wireless Communication Market](../../../reports/next-generation-wireless-communication-market-1148) to develop and expand significantly. Established organizations like China Mobile and China Telecom are major contributors to this growth, investing heavily in infrastructure to support next-generation wireless communication technologies, such as 5G and beyond. By enhancing their network capabilities, these companies can accommodate the increasing consumer demand, thus paving the way for further innovations and expansions in the market.

**Next Generation Wireless Communication Market Technology Insights**

The Technology segment within the China Next Generation Wireless Communication Market has been a focal point of innovation and growth, reflecting the rapid advancements in telecommunications. This segment encompasses several critical elements, including Wireless Local Area Networks (Wireless LAN), 3G, 4G Long-Term Evolution (4G LTE), and 5G technologies. Wireless LAN plays a vital role in providing high-speed internet access within localized areas and is essential for the proliferation of smart devices and the Internet of Things (IoT) in urban settings.

This technology not only supports connectivity but also enhances productivity across various sectors, making it foundational in the development of smart cities.As for 3G, it served as the initial transformative leap into mobile connectivity in China, enabling data services and mobile internet usage, setting the stage for subsequent technological advancements. 4G LTE followed as an enhancement, bringing faster data speeds and improved network efficiency.

It facilitated richer multimedia applications, including high-definition video streaming and online gaming, thus driving significant user engagement and altering consumer behavior. The rise of 4G LTE significantly contributed to the growth of mobile commerce and e-learning platforms in China, allowing businesses to reach a larger audience with mobile-responsive services.

Currently, 5G technology stands out as a game-changer within the sector, promising unparalleled speed and connectivity improvements, making it significant for various applications such as autonomous driving, telemedicine, and massive IoT deployments. The Chinese government has placed considerable emphasis on expanding 5G infrastructure, recognizing its potential to fuel economic growth and boost technological competitiveness on a global scale.

The rapid deployment of 5G is expected to reshape numerous industries, including automotive, healthcare, and logistics, by enabling real-time communication and reducing latency. Overall, the Technology segment in the China Next Generation Wireless Communication Market reflects a constant evolution, driven by consumer demand and strategic governmental initiatives aimed at positioning China as a leader in global telecommunications. The foundations laid by previous generations of mobile technologies, alongside the ongoing innovations in 5G, keep this segment at the forefront of market growth and technological advancement.

**China Next Generation Wireless Communication****Market****Developments**

In recent months, the China Next Generation Wireless Communication Market has witnessed significant developments. Companies such as Huawei and ZTE continue to play key roles in 5G infrastructure deployment across the country, with both firms actively cooperating with major telecom operators like China Mobile and China Telecom to enhance network capabilities. In November 2023, Ericsson announced a strategic partnership with China Unicom aimed at expanding 5G coverage in urban and rural areas.

Additionally, in October 2023, Qualcomm reported a collaboration with Tsinghua Unigroup to accelerate advancements in 5G semiconductor technology. The market is also seeing notable growth in valuation, driven by increased demand for high-speed wireless services as the digital economy expands. Over the last two to three years, major investments in Research and Development have been noted, especially by firms like Nokia and Broadcom, to foster innovation in wireless technology.

The Chinese government's push for digital transformation and smart city initiatives further fuels this market's growth. Mergers and acquisitions remain subdued, with no significant deals reported during this period among the specified companies, reflecting a cautious approach amidst ongoing geopolitical tensions.
